Recommended Knowledge

1. What Is a Mempool

The mempool is the pool of pending, unconfirmed transactions that nodes hold before they are included in a block. It is the waiting room of a blockchain.

2. How It Works

When a user broadcasts a transaction, nodes validate it and add it to their local mempool. Miners/validators select transactions from the mempool (typically prioritizing higher fees) to include in the next block. Mempools vary by node — transactions visible there are not yet final. Public mempools enable MEV extraction, sandwich attacks, and front-running.

3. Why It Matters

The mempool is where transaction inclusion is decided — fee competition happens there, and it is the front line of MEV. Understanding mempool dynamics (fee market, ordering) matters for users wanting timely inclusion and for protocols exposed to front-running. Private mempools and order-flow auctions aim to protect users.

4. Key Facts

  • Mempool size spikes during congestion
  • Priority fees (EIP-1559 tips) influence selection
  • MEV bots monitor mempools for profitable opportunities
  • Private/encrypted mempools (e.g., Flashbots, Shutter) mitigate MEV
